The radiator cap is designed with a higher pressure rating than OEM caps in order to raise your coolants boiling point. This reduces boiling over and losing coolant. Equipped on top of the cap is a temperature gauge so you can read how hot or cold your machine running.Higher pressure radiator with. Gauge on top identifies how hot or cold a machine is running.
Cap pressure rating is 1.8kg/cm2 25.6psi. The Tusk High Pressure Radiator Cap with Temperature Gauge makes it easy to keep an eye on your machines temperature. Built with a higher pressure rating than the OEM cap to raise boiling point of your machine this reduces boil-overs.
